Man Wearing Tyrannosaurus Rex Costume While Riding a Horse Kicks Soccer Balls Around

“Jurassic Paso Park!” by Gascon Horsemanship features championship horseback rider Michael Gascon of Poplarville, Mississippi wearing a Tyrannosaurus rex costume while riding a horse that kicks around a large soccer ball and performs all sorts of impressive tricks.